Understanding Casino Non Gamstop Platforms
A casino non gamstop is essentially an online gambling operator that doesn’t fall under the jurisdiction of the UK Gambling Commission, and therefore isn’t obligated to follow GamStop’s self-exclusion protocols. GamStop allows individuals to self-exclude from all online casinos licensed in Great Britain. This can be a valuable tool for those struggling with problem gambling, however, it doesn’t cover offshore casinos. This has led to the rise of non-GamStop casinos, which cater to players who have already self-excluded or prefer not to be limited by such restrictions. The critical aspect to understand is the regulatory landscape; these casinos are often licensed by other jurisdictions, such as Curacao or Malta.
| Jurisdiction | Licensing Authority | Player Protection |
|---|---|---|
| Curacao | Curacao eGaming | Often less stringent |
| Malta | Malta Gaming Authority | Generally high standards |
| Gibraltar | Gibraltar Regulatory Authority | Robust regulations |

Understanding Bonus Offers and Wagering Requirements
Many casino non gamstop sites entice players with generous bonus offers. However, it’s essential to carefully read the terms and conditions associated with these bonuses. Wagering requirements, also known as playthrough requirements, dictate how many times you must bet the b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ings. High wagering requirements can make it difficult to actually cash out your bonus funds, so choose offers with reasonable terms. Be aware of any game restrictions or maximum bet limits that may apply.
It’s also important to differentiate between various bonus types – deposit bonuses, free spins, no-deposit bonuses – and understand their implications for your gameplay.
